Understanding Sevierville, TN

Sevierville, nestled at the foothills of the Great Smoky Mountains, is a popular tourist destination renowned for its natural beauty, family-friendly attractions like Dollywood, and Southern hospitality. But like any location, it’s essential to consider the experiences of all travelers.

Safety and Inclusivity in Sevierville

While Sevierville generally enjoys a reputation for safety, it’s important to acknowledge that personal experiences can vary. The question of safety for Black travelers is a complex one, intertwined with broader conversations about race and equality in America.

Here’s what we know:

  • Tourism Focus: Sevierville has a strong tourism industry, and businesses generally strive to create a welcoming atmosphere for all visitors.
  • Local Culture: The American South, including Tennessee, has a complex history regarding race relations. While progress has been made, it’s crucial to acknowledge this history.
  • Personal Experiences: The best way to gauge safety is to hear from Black travelers themselves. Online travel forums and reviews can offer valuable insights.

Tips for a Safe and Enjoyable Trip

Regardless of your background, these tips can contribute to a positive experience in Sevierville:

  • Plan Ahead: Research accommodations, restaurants, and activities in advance.
  • Connect with Locals: Engage in conversations with local residents to gain a deeper understanding of the area.
  • Support Black-Owned Businesses: Seek out and support businesses owned by people of color to contribute to the local economy and experience a different perspective.
  • Be Aware of Surroundings: Like any tourist destination, stay aware of your surroundings, especially at night.
